Hi everyone,

 

Just thought i'd give you a quick update.

 

The inquest goes on regarding our systems but we think we have a 'handle' on the situation now and some clarity has emerged.

 

On checking ALL our order forms for the twin packs and buffet cars, Kevin does indeed tell me that apart from 1 transposed order  which wasnt fulfilled, stockists who ordered them did indeed get them and orders in general were very poor.

 

However, as posted before we have e-mailed all 170+ traders who have active accounts with us (yesterday morning) with news that they can order for immediate delivery both the 3 x buffet cars already out and the 2 x twin packs that are also here, and we have had 1 response so far for an order of 2 FGW buffet cars.

We have hard copied those that dont have e-mail and hope to get more orders through those remaining 20+ if possible.

 

So it looks on the whole as though these will be very slow sellers as not many stockists have or will order them (ergo have no stock).

If the situation develops at all, then i will of course, let you all know here, but at present it doesnt look too hopeful.

 

Please feel free to order direct from Dapol, or canvass your stockist to order them in for you if required
